Plympton · Statistical Area 2 (SA2)
How people contribute — volunteering, unpaid care and domestic work, and defence service.
Nearly one quarter of Plympton residents provide unpaid childcare, making it the most common form of community contribution in the area. While many locals help out at home and in the community, these rates are generally lower than in other similar parts of the state.
Volunteering for organisations and groups.
About 15% of people here volunteer their time, which is around the middle for similar areas. This is a little below the South Australian figure of 17%, and it has fallen slightly since 2011.

Caring for others and unpaid domestic work.
Unpaid work is less common here than in most areas, with only 18.2% of people doing 15 or more hours of housework. Similarly, those providing unpaid care or looking after children are a little below the state and national figures.

People who served in the Australian Defence Force.
Defence service is lower than in most areas, with 2.4% of the population having served. This is about the same as the figures for South Australia and the rest of the country.
